Application
- Water-based nanofluids, which are used in engine cooling, heat exchangers, and nuclear cooling system. In graphene oxide/alumina nanofluid, the addition of aluminum nanoparticles improves the physical structure of graphene oxide and reduces the viscosity of the composite.
- Polysiloxane-aluminum oxide composites, applicable as an elastomeric thermal pad for light-emitting diodes.
Features and Benefits
- Stable in a harsh non-biological environment.
- They can be easily prepared through established synthesis methods.
- A vast surface area allows conjugation with chemical and biological molecules.
- Their surface modification protocols are straightforward.
- They can easily interact with biological interfaces.
